As the first four caliphs, abu bakr, umar, uthman, and ali, had each a spiritual station commensurate with the function they performed, they are called alkhulafa arrashidun, the rightly guided or the patriarchal caliphs glasse 112. The sunni term the four rightly guided caliphs was first used by the abbasid dynasty to refer to the four first political leaders after the prophets death. All four were among thc earliest and closest companions of the prophet peace be on him. The first four caliphs of islam, who occupy a special place in islam, are referred to as alkhulafaurrashidun the rightly guided caliphs because they are deemed to have faithfully followed the example of muhammad in leading the muslim community of which they were the religious, political, military and judicial heads. Muslims believe their rule reflected the ideals and goals of muhammad.
